// Config hot-reloading for the Brindlemere client.
// The watcher polls /etc/brindlemere/client.toml every 15s and applies
// changes without a restart. Connection pool size, retry budgets, and
// timeout values are all reloadable; endpoint URLs are not, by design,
// since swapping hosts mid-flight corrupted the session cache in the
// 3.2 release. Reload events are logged at INFO so the release manager
// can confirm rollout without shelling in. The client authenticates to
// the internal Fennic registry with the key that follows.

app token of tageg-kadug = vxb2-26

# Break-Glass: Catalog Cache Invalidation

Scope: the Pinrow product catalog at Veldstone Retail. If stale prices persist after a purge and the Hollowmere invalidation queue is wedged, use break-glass to flush the edge tier directly. Contractors: get verbal sign-off from the catalog lead first. Steps: open the Hollowmere admin shell, select emergency-flush, confirm the tenant, and run it once — repeated flushes thrash the origin. Access is logged and expires after 20 minutes. Unseal the admin shell with the passphrase below.

recovery phrase for kahop-tajog: istix-casvan

- [ ] Step 7: Archive cold storage buckets (Glacierline tier). Confirm both ceremony witnesses are present, verify bucket manifests match the Oxbow ledger, then seal the archive key shares. Plugin authors may observe but not handle shares. Once sealed, the archive index itself is encrypted and can only be reopened with the passphrase below.

vault phrase of badup-hahig = tamael-aldael-kelmir-istael-fenok-istwyn-tamius-jorath-oliion